Objectives

4.1 to provide help, support and protection to children, families and individuals who are in conditions of poverty, vulnerability or distress or who are otherwise in need by reason of their personal, social or economic circumstances. and 4.2 to advance education, policy and practice in health and social services through study of the conditions that harm affect children and families and through dissemination of the knowledge gained through that study and the experience of service provision.
